What Are Soccer Odds?
Soccer odds represent the bookmakers' estimation of the probability of a specific outcome in a soccer match. These odds influence how much you can win from a bet, which is essential for both novice and experienced bettors. There are three common formats for displaying soccer odds: fractional, decimal, and moneyline.

Understanding Odds Movement
Odds can fluctuate leading up to a match based on various factors such as team form, player injuries, and betting patterns. Here’s how to interpret odds movement:
Decreased Odds: When odds drop for a team, it generally indicates that more bettors believe that team will win, signaling a positive shift in perceived performance.
Increased Odds: If odds increase, it could denote a lack of confidence in that team’s ability to win, perhaps due to player injuries or poor form.

When selecting a bookmaker, consider their reputation, odds offered, available markets, and customer service. You can check reviews and compare bookmakers to find the best fit for your needs.
Various types of soccer bets include match result (1X2), over/under goals, Asian handicap, first goalscorer, and correct score. Understanding these options can improve your betting strategy.
Bookmakers assess various factors, including team form, historical data, and expert analysis, to set odds. They aim to balance their books by offering odds that entice betting on all potential outcomes.
